Package Handler Salary (2026): How Much Does a Package Handler Make?
From entry‑level wages to senior pay, see how experience and specialization boost your salary.
Package Handler pay typically centers around $38,500, with entry-level roles around $28,000 – $32,000 per year (US), mid-career roles around $40,000 – $45,000 per year (US), senior roles around $55,000 – $60,000 per year (US), and top earners reaching $70,000+ per year (US).
- Entry level: $28,000 – $32,000 per year (US)
- Mid-career: $40,000 – $45,000 per year (US)
- Senior: $55,000 – $60,000 per year (US)
- Top 10%: $70,000+ per year (US)

Demand for package handlers is expected to grow steadily as e‑commerce expands and supply‑chain automation increases. The BLS projects a 4% overall employment growth through 2030, with higher hiring rates in major logistics hubs and during peak shopping seasons.

How much does a Package Handler make?
Package Handler pay typically centers around $38,500, with entry-level roles around $28,000 – $32,000 per year (US), mid-career roles around $40,000 – $45,000 per year (US), senior roles around $55,000 – $60,000 per year (US), and top earners reaching $70,000+ per year (US).
What is an entry-level Package Handler salary?
An entry-level Package Handler salary is typically around $28,000 – $32,000 per year (US), based on the salary snapshot for professionals with roughly 0-2 years of experience.
What is the highest Package Handler salary?
Senior Package Handler roles are listed around $55,000 – $60,000 per year (US), while top earners can reach $70,000+ per year (US) depending on experience, market, and specialization.
Which industry pays Package Handlers the most?
E‑commerce fulfillment is one of the strongest salary paths for Package Handlers, with an average salary of $39,000.
What affects Package Handler pay the most?
Package Handler pay is most affected by Geographic location and cost‑of‑living, Shift differentials (night, weekend, holiday), Union membership and collective bargaining, Years of experience and seniority. Location and specialization can change the salary range substantially even for the same job title.
Can certifications increase a Package Handler salary?
Yes. Certifications can improve earning potential for Package Handlers. For example, OSHA Safety Certification is listed with a potential salary impact of +$2,000 annually.
